apifox中如何将响应结果中的值打印出来
时间: 2024-04-15 19:31:36 浏览: 20
在 APIFOX 中,你可以通过以下步骤将响应结果中的值打印出来1. 首先,确保你已发送了 API 请求并获取到了响应结果。
2. 在你的代码中,找到处理 API 响应的部分。
3. 使用合适的方法或函数来解析响应结果,这取决于你所使用的编程语言和框架。常见的方法包括使用 JSON 解析库或内置的 JSON 解析函数。
4. 一旦你成功解析了响应结果,你可以通过打印函数或日志函数来将值打印出来。具体的打印方法也取决于你所使用的编程语言和框架。在大多数编程语言中,你可以使用 `print()` 函数来实现打印功能。
下面是一个使用 Python 的示例代码,展示了如何将 APIFOX 响应结果中的值打印出来:
```python
import requests
import json
# 发送 API 请求并获取响应结果
response = requests.get('https://api.api-fox.com/user')
# 解析响应结果
data = json.loads(response.text)
# 打印值
print(data['key1'])
print(data['key2'])
```
请注意,以上示例代码仅供参考,实际实现中可能需要根据你的具体情况进行适当调整。
相关问题
利用apifox怎么设置响应参数的值
在使用 APIFOX 设置响应参数的值时,您需要按照以下步骤操作:
1. 打开 APIFOX 并进入您的项目。
2. 在“接口列表”中选择要编辑响应参数的接口。
3. 在右侧的“响应”选项卡中,选择您要编辑的响应参数。
4. 在“响应参数”下方,您可以看到“值”栏。单击该栏后,您可以手动输入您想要的值。
5. 如果您需要使用动态值,可以在“值”栏中使用 APIFOX 提供的函数和变量。例如,您可以使用“$now”变量来插入当前时间。
请注意,您必须在请求中发送正确的参数值,才能正确接收到 APIFOX 返回的响应参数值。
apifox中期待code为静态值
在APIFox中,期待code为静态值是指在API的设计和实现过程中,希望code这个字段的值是固定不变的,不会随着每次请求的发起而发生变化。
通常情况下,API的响应结果中会包含一个code字段,用于表示请求的执行结果或者状态。如果希望这个code的值是静态值,那么无论是不是相同的请求,响应结果中的code都是一样的。
使用静态值的好处是可以在客户端或者其他接收响应的系统中做一些基于固定值的处理。比如,可以根据不同的code值执行不同的操作逻辑,或者根据code来判断请求是否成功等。
为了实现code为静态值,需要在API的设计和实现过程中注意以下几点:
1. 在设计API时,明确定义code字段的用途和取值范围,并确保这些取值是固定、不变的。
2. 在实现API时,保证每次请求的响应结果中的code字段取值都是相同的,不受请求参数的影响。
3. 在API的文档和说明中清楚地说明code字段是一个静态值,不会随着请求的变化而变化。
总的来说,期待code为静态值是为了在API的使用过程中能够对请求的结果或状态进行准确的判断和处理,提高接口的可靠性和稳定性。